POSITION SUMMARY:

This position is responsible for monitoring and maintaining all equipment associated with and not limited to remote compressor stations, valve sites and pipelines. This position is responsible for the daily operational duties associated with and not limited to the process of gathering, and transportation of natural gas and natural gas liquids. Some of these duties will include compressor and engine preventative maintenance, assisting with compressor and engine overhauls, station loss control, testing and monitoring of engine and compressor performance, maintaining, operating and repairing gas dehydration equipment, maintaining, operating and repairing all gas process equipment, from station inlet through station discharge.

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ES:
  • Operates production equipment, including engines, dehydration equipment, filter vessels, environmental controls, pumps, compressors, separators, free water knockouts, gas gathering systems, and central tank batteries.
  • Gauges tanks and checks pump action to maintain pipeline pressure within guidelines.
  • Collects fluid/gas samples and conducts production and fluid tests.
  • Provides maintenance and repairs to facilities and equipment.
  • Practice awareness concerning issues of health, safety and the environment.
  • Can include OQ-covered responsibilities similar to Pigging Technicians, Pipeline Operators, and Corrosion Technicians.
